Ahmedabad: Amid rising concerns over ragging in educational institutions, Gujarat has recorded 86 ragging complaints between 2022 and 2026, with 23 cases reported from medical colleges, accounting for more than 26 percent of the total cases reported in the state. According to the data, Gujarat recorded 105 ragging complaints between 2012 and 2022, while 86 complaints were reported in just the next four years, highlighting the continuing concern over ragging in the state.
